How can I get a cheap car rental in King County?
Below we've listed our best tips and tricks to help you keep more money in your wallet:

  • Use our clever filter feature to help steer you in the direction of the hottest car deals around — and then compare the prices;
  • Organize an email Price Drop Alert for your next exciting vacation destination. You never know what terrific bargains will hightail it into your inbox;
  • Before you pick up your keys and hop behind the wheel, check out both airport and non-airport pickup and drop-off outlets to make sure you're getting your hands on the cheapest deal in town;
  • If you have room to move in your schedule, modify your dates to find lower prices on different days of the week;
  • Pickup and drop-off times often need to be similar (e.g, both 11 a.m.) or you may be charged for an extra day unnecessarily;
  • If you're hoping to keep some extra cash in your pocket, pay right away and get some of the cheapest rates around;
  • Don't let the deal you've been searching for slip through your grasp. Book as soon as you can and secure your dream ride.

What side of the road do they drive on in King County?
In King County, you'll have to stick to the right-hand side. When traveling someplace new, it's always a good idea to go for a vehicle with automatic transmission. That way, you can focus on the road ahead and not worry about gear changes.
Are there speed limits in King County?
There sure are. Typically, speed limits in King County range from 20mph to 75mph. In built-up areas, you're not usually allowed to drive over 20mph.
What happens if I get a speeding fine while driving a rental car in Washington?
One of two things will happen. Your chosen car rental company may bill the fined amount to your credit card. This is the usual practice. Or it may give your contact details to the relevant local agency so the fine is issued straight to you.
